Located on an unparalleled site of close to 1,000 acres between I-95 and Rt. 40, with sweeping views of the upper Chesapeake Bay, The Residences at Bulle Rock form a unique residential community built around the state’s premier five-star public golf course designed by Pete Dye. Currently under construction, the gated community will comprise approximately 2,000 upscale condos, villas and single-family homes built by Clark Turner, D.R. Horton, NVHomes, Ryan Homes and Ryland Homes. This new community also features a 30-acre corporate campus with future development opportunities for five additional buildings, bringing the total to 254,000 square feet. A retail and commercial center fronting Rt. 40 is currently under development.
- Mixed-use residential, corporate office, golf course community
- 1,000 acres of prime waterfront vista property
- 2,000 units of luxury condominiums, villas and single-family homes
- Minutes from I-95 and adjacent to Rt. 40
- Award-winning, five-star, Pete Dye-designed public golf course, current host of the LPGA (attendance of over 100,000 in 2006)
- Prime location for potential “BRAC” resettlement
- 2006 population estimate within 20 mile radius of 348,127, expected to swell by 30,000 (379,552) with Base resettlement to 139,500 households in 2011.
- Average 2006 HH income of $71,405 within 20 miles
